la frase

Usages of la frase

Può capitare di sbagliare una frase quando si scrive in fretta.
It can happen that you make a mistake in a sentence when you write quickly.
Il significato di questa frase cambia molto se togli l’accento.
The meaning of this sentence changes a lot if you remove the accent.
C’è un apostrofo in quella frase, ma non c’è nessuna parentesi.
There is an apostrophe in that sentence, but there are no parentheses.
Questa virgola non solo cambia il ritmo della frase, ma anche il suo significato.
This comma not only changes the rhythm of the sentence, but also its meaning.
Quando il significato non è chiaro, la professoressa ci invita a riscrivere la frase con parole più semplici.
When the meaning is not clear, the teacher invites us to rewrite the sentence with simpler words.
Manca una virgoletta in quella frase.
A quotation mark is missing in that sentence.
Scrivendo in fretta, dimentico spesso la maiuscola all’inizio della frase.
Writing quickly, I often forget the capital letter at the beginning of the sentence.
In questa frase il verbo viene prima del sostantivo.
In this sentence, the verb comes before the noun.
La traduzione di questa frase non è difficile, ma voglio che suoni naturale.
The translation of this sentence is not difficult, but I want it to sound natural.
Se l’avverbio è al posto giusto, la frase suona meglio; se sbaglio la preposizione, invece, il significato cambia subito.
If the adverb is in the right place, the sentence sounds better; if I get the preposition wrong, on the other hand, the meaning changes immediately.
Non dimenticare il punto alla fine della frase.
Don't forget the period at the end of the sentence.
Non capisco il senso di questa frase.
I do not understand the meaning of this sentence.
In quella frase manca il trattino tra le due parole.
In that sentence, the hyphen between the two words is missing.
